S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
Read the operating instructions carefully before use.
Save them for future reference.
Read these instructions carefully before use, and save them for future reference. The troubleshooting guide helps
you to identify the causes of common problems and how they can be rectied. Contact your dealer if you
experience a problem that is not included in this troubleshooting guide.
The dehumidier is not intended to be used by persons (children or adults) with any form of functional disorders,
or by persons who do not have sucient experience or knowledge on how to use it, unless they have received
instructions concerning the use of the dehumidier from someone who is responsible for their safety. Keep
children under supervision to make sure they do not play with the dehumidier. Do not allow children to use,
clean or maintain the dehumidier without supervision.
Keep children under supervision to make sure they do not play with the dehumidier.
A damaged power cord must be replaced by an authorised service centre, or other qualied personnel, to ensure
safe use.
The appliance dehumidier must be installed in accordance with the instructions and local regulations.
Do not place the dehumidier closer than 1 m to any ammable material.
Maintenance and repairs must be carried out by an authorised service centre.
Do not overload the power point or connection.
Do not start/stop the dehumidier by disconnecting/reconnecting the power supply.
Do not use a damaged or unsuitable power cord.
Never modify the power cord or plug. Connect the dehumidier to a separate power circuit. Do not touch the
power cord or the plug with wet hands.
Do not place the dehumidier near sources of heat. Fire risk.
Switch o the dehumidier immediately and unplug the power cord in the event of any abnormal noise, smell,
smoke or other abnormality.
Never attempt to dismantle or repair the dehumidier yourself.
Switch o the dehumidier and unplug the power cord before cleaning.
Do not use the dehumidier in the vicinity of ammable liquids or gases.
Do not drink the water from the dehumidier.
Switch o the dehumidier before removing the water container.
Do not move the dehumidier when there is water in the water container.
IMPORTANT:
Do not use the dehumidier in conned spaces.
Do not expose the dehumidier to splashing water.
Place the dehumidier on a level, stable surface.
Never cover the inlet or outlet openings.
Do not use the dehumidier in the vicinity of chemicals.
Never poke your ngers or any other objects into the inlet or outlet openings.
Do not place heavy objects on the power cord. Place the power cord so that it cannot be stood on or clenched.
Do not step or sit on the dehumidier.
Always make sure to t the lter properly. Clean the lter every other week.
If water gets into the dehumidier, switch it o, unplug the power cord and contact an authorised service centre or
other qualied personnel.
Never place objects lled with water, such as vases, on the dehumidier.
